Summary of the comparison
George Eliot Academy and Etone College are secondary schools in Nuneaton.
George Eliot Academy scores 57 out of 100 (grade C, average) and Etone College scores 61 out of 100 (grade C, average). Etone College is ahead on our composite score.
George Eliot Academy was judged the expected standard and Etone College was judged Good.
On GCSE Attainment 8, the latest published figures are 45.8 for George Eliot Academy and 47.3 for Etone College.
GCSE Attainment 8 has held broadly level at George Eliot Academy (45.9 in 2021-22, 45.8 in 2024-25) and has fallen at Etone College (55.3 in 2021-22, 47.3 in 2024-25).
